Saffron exports increase to 172.7 million USD in 10 months 

TEHRAN – Iran’s saffron exports amounted to $172,758 million in the first ten months of the current Iranian calendar year (March 21, 2022 to January 20, 2023), according to data released by the Republic’s Customs Service Islamic Iran (IRICA) announced. 

Austria, Jordan, Argentina, Spain, Australia, South Africa, Afghanistan, Germany, United Arab Emirates, Indonesia, UK, Italy, USA, Ireland, Bahrain, Belgium, Pakistan, Portugal, Thailand Lan, Taiwan, Turkey, Azerbaijan, Czech Republic, China, Denmark, Zambia, Japan, Sri Lanka, Singapore, Switzerland, Sweden, Serbia, Montenegro, Iraq, Oman, Russia, France, Philippines, Kazakhstan, Qatar, Cambodia, Canada, Croatia, Korea, Kenya, Kuwait, Georgia, Lebanon, Malaysia, Hungary, Egypt, Mauritius, Norway, Nigeria, New Zealand, Vietnam, Netherlands, India, Hong Kong and Greece are 59 Iranian saffron customers in the 10 months mentioned, IRICA reported. 

The United Arab Emirates is the biggest customer of Iranian saffron with the purchase of the product worth more than $61.739 million, followed by Spain with the purchase of Iranian saffron worth more than $38 million.

China comes in third place with $32 million worth of saffron purchases in the first ten months of the current Iranian calendar year.

Iran’s saffron exports exceed $240 million 

TEHRAN, April 29 (MNA) – A total of $244.22 million worth of saffron was exported from Iran in the past year Iran ended March 20, according to data from the Agriculture Ministry for the fiscal year. main 2022-2023. 

The United Arab Emirates, Spain and China are the main destinations.

Iran produces more than 90% of all saffron produced in the world, 80% of which is exported.

However, Iran’s share of the global saffron trade is very small, as many of Iran’s spice customers buy it in bulk and re-export it after packaging to third countries, the Financial Tribune reported. .

The city of Torbat-e Heydariyeh in Khorasan Razavi province is considered the saffron capital of the world.
